However how does one shade a Cybertruck? Nice query. Word that earlier we stated re-color, not repaint. This as a result of Cybertrucks aren’t painted in any respect. The massive beast’s physique panels are fabricated from brushed chrome steel, a end which doesn’t take properly to color, and is as an alternative meant to function the top product.
In lieu of paint, Cybertruck house owners are turning to “wraps,” utilized mylar-like materials that’s layered over the physique panels and could be—usually—eliminated on the proprietor’s discretion.
Per Tesla, “…these wraps are constituted of polyvinyl chloride, making them further sturdy, versatile and detachable. Select between matte, satin and gloss finishes.”
For a brief Whereas, Tesla was each promoting the wrap materials, and arranging for software on the maker’s official service facilities. Per a variety of message boards, Tesla is not dealing with wrap set up, although there are many outlets able to dealing with the job. Wrapping vehicles is a reasonably widespread customization choice nowadays, and never only for automobiles fabricated from chrome steel.
Per the identical message boards, the price of having your Cybertruck wrapped can run as excessive as $10,000, although the determine we noticed most frequently was $6500, together with the price of the wrap materials itself.
In comparison with the premium paint choices on some new vehicles, which may run from as little as $300, to greater than $2500 on a Porsche mannequin, wrapping a automobile strikes us as costly. Compounding the expense is the life expectancy of the wrap itself. Whereas well-applied, well-cared-for wraps are understood to final so long as eight years, some therapies fail to final simply two years.
A fast survey—once more of message boards—suggests that the majority wrap therapies will final four-five years, which doesn’t look like lengthy sufficient given the worth. Moreover, some Cbyertruck house owners are complaining on-line that the vinyl is tough to take away from the truck’s stainless-steel panels, leaving the end discolored.
